Supplemental Indentures Without Consent of Bondholders. The Authority and the Trustee, may, without the consent of the registered owners of the Bonds then outstanding, from time to time and at any time, enter into such indentures supplemental hereto (which supplemental indentures shall thereafter form a part hereof):
